我想更改OPTIMIZER_FEATURES_ENABLE
本地安装的 Oracle 9i(在 Windows Server 2003 上运行的 32 位 9.2.0.1.0 企业版)中的参数,以尝试重现客户报告的性能问题,但我不知道该怎么做。ALTER SESSION
andALTER SYSTEM
语句都会触发此错误(即使以 SYS 身份运行):
ORA-02095: 无法修改指定的初始化参数
我该如何改变它?
更新:
我遵循的步骤(感谢Gary 的回答) 是这样的:
创建一个空文件:
C:\oracle\ora92\DBS\INIT.ORA
编辑文件以添加:
optimizer_features_enabled = 8.1.7
启动 Windows 服务管理器
重新启动名为的服务
OracleServiceFOO
,其中 FOO 是我的实例名称
答案1
它是静态参数因此需要在 pfile/spfile 中进行更改,然后重新启动实例。